I have synchronized THOUSANDS of sets of carburetors and made a statement based on that experience and will stand by it. Making the idle mixture right prior to synchronizing any carburetor is necessary and the closer to correct, the easier it is to sync. I also have an EGA and several very professional sets of sync gauges. They DO NOT make all the difference in the world when tuning; experience does.

As far as the problem at hand, since the idle problem seems to be erratic or not happening on a consistent basis, try jiggling the choke plunger knob next time it happens. If the choke plunger pads are not seating, this will seat them and alert you to the next step in resolving the problem.
